Frequently Asked Questions about Greenup
How much are Studio apartments in Greenup?
There are currently 8 Studio Apartments in Greenup with rent ranges from $650 to $1,400 with an average price of $1,010.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Greenup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Greenup ranges from $503 to $2,692 with an average monthly rent of $950.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Greenup c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Greenup range from $600 to $3,102.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,044.
How expensive are Greenup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 16 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Greenup on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$850 to $1,615 - averaging $1,214 for the location.
